    When Sage called me back an hour later, I went to show him the issue, and lo and behold, no error - it just finished the conversion. Apparently, another analyst took another call reporting the exact same issue about the same time I opened my case. Theory is that perhaps Sage Exchange couldn't communicate w/ the ""Vault"" at that time. Ronnie Aspe was who I was working with, and he said he'd check in w/ Sage Payment Solutions to see if there was an interruption in service. I'll follow up on that. I also got an education on how to install Sage Exchange if it somehow doesn't install as part of WKSETUP (i.e. you don't see the SE icon in the system tray): 1. if you access any place in MAS that requires accessing CC data, it will get installed automatically (I think - either that or it prompts you first). 2. There are 2 components required for SE: The Module SDK and Sage Exchange itself. You should see them both in Control Panel\Programs. If they aren't present, you can manually install them from the 2013 install ""DVD"" by navigating in WIndows Explorer to the folder \Prerequisites\SageExchange\setup.msi to install the SDK, and \BARESETUP\SageExchange.application to launch the SageExchange installer. Note: you can also launch the SDK from inside the WKSETUP\Prerequisites folder. But the SageExchange installer is not located there. You can also launch the SDK from the installer program for Sage 100 under Productivity Applications.

    I ended up calling Sage - initially they sent me the attached article talking about rebuilding, uninstalling/reinstalling, etc. I pushed back a bit and Dennis at Sage was nice enough to connect. Although I had deleted and purged credit card history, there was still one credit card record in the 4.4 AR_CustomerCreditCard table (deleted using DFDM). We also cleared out the SY_CreditCardRestart table (in 5.0) where it was getting stuck on the conversion, also using DFDM. Then copied the company data back over, converted and it worked.

    In sage exchange - bottom right - make sure you go to settings - and then work your way down on left to register and look at the right - there should be a long random key if not keep toying with it and restart till a key is there also. This is critical to communications and conversions to the sage vault conversion.
